All glass pintype insulators are classified in what is called the “CD Numbering” program of identification. “Woody” Woodward, an early pioneer, researcher and author in the field of collecting glass insulators. The CD numbers essentially determine insulators by their shape and profile, regardless of exact embossed markings, glass colour, or base kind.

Glass insulators had been initial created in the 1850’s for use with telegraph lines. As technology developed insulators have been necessary for phone lines, electric energy lines, and other applications. In the mid 1960’s a few individuals started collecting these antique glass insulators. Insulator clubs, local and national shows, and excellent reference books are readily available. A pin insulator is typically made from porcelain, but glass or plastic could also be made use of in some cases. As pin insulators are nearly normally employed in open air, suitable insulation though raining is also an essential consideration. A wet pin insulator could provide a path for present to flow towards the pole. To overcome this trouble, pin insulators are designed with rain sheds or petticoats. Beyond operating voltage of 33kV, pin insulators grow to be also bulky and uneconomical.

Double insulation demands that the devices have each fundamental and supplementary insulation, each of which is enough to avoid electric shock. All internal electrically energized components are completely enclosed within an insulated physique that prevents any get in touch with with “reside” parts. In the EU, double insulated appliances all are marked with a symbol of two squares, 1 inside the other. Numerous suspension insulators use nearly identical insulating shells, but the caps vary in size and shape based on manufacturer choice, and the load bearing capacity of the given insulator. We think to classify each and every of these minor variations defeats the objective of a handy numbering program, and that an interested collector can simply note the variety of cap they have on a offered insulator.
